原文:C++类中创建线程

经常会遇到需要在类中创建线程,可以使用静态成员函数,并且将类实例的指针传入线程函数的方式来实现。 实现代码代码如下: ...

2019-08-25 20:34 0 2306 推荐指数:

查看详情

创建自己的C++

使用Unreal Editor创建C++ 点击新增 选择父类 命名 手工创建C++ 在工程目录的Source文件夹下,找到和游戏名称一致的文件夹,有下面两种文件结构: public文件夹,private文件夹,.build.cs文件 一堆.cpp和.h ...

Mon Jul 01 07:13:00 CST 2019 0 429
c++创建与使用

c++创建与使用 前言: 之前一直对c++创建与使用不太熟悉,有些概念还是有点模糊,借着这次休息的机会整理一下对应是知识点。如有不正确的地方还希望各位读者批评指正。 一.C++public、protect、private的访问权限控制 继承修饰符,就像是一种筛子,将基类的成员筛 ...

Sat Feb 22 16:55:00 CST 2020 0 6410
C++线程创建启动线程及查看线程id

创建线程   子线程创建时启动。使用功能std::thread创建线程对象。   线程关联的可调对象可以是:普通函数、仿函数对象、Lambda表达式、非静态成员函数、静态成员函数。 示例   普通函数   仿函数对象   Lambda表达式 ...

Sat Jun 06 19:29:00 CST 2020 0 3497
四种方式创建c++线程

线程和进程概念关系: 进程是一组离散的(执行)程序任务集合; 线程是进程上下文中执行的代码序列; 两者之间具体关系: 线程是进程的可执行单元,是计算机分配CPU机时的基本单元。一个进程可以包含一个或多个线程,进程是通过线程去执行代码的。同一个进程的多个线程共享该进程的资源和操作系统 ...

Sat Jan 30 00:43:00 CST 2021 0 2214
C++用pthread_create()创建线程

pthread_create()是Linux创建线程的一种方式。 用到多线程,就用for语句循环创建多个线程,但是出现了一些问题,特此记录下。 原代码: 创建线程时是需要把a传入函数function的,但是,这样会出现混乱,比如,我们需要往第0个线程 ...

Sat Jan 30 01:14:00 CST 2021 0 870
线程池原理及创建C++实现)

本文给出了一个通用的线程池框架,该框架将与线程执行相关的任务进行了高层次的抽象,使之与具体的执行任务无关。另外该线程池具有动态伸缩性,它能根据执行任务的轻重自动调整线程池中线程的数量。文章的最后,我们给出一个简单示例程序,通过该示例程序,我们会发现,通过该线程池框架执行多线程任务是多么的简单 ...

Wed Sep 18 22:40:00 CST 2013 5 27245
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M